Microsemi Corp. thru SANTA ANA, CA / SCOTTSDALE, AZ LDTS48A / For more information cal (602) 941-6300 FEATURES TRANSIENT This series is used in automotive and vehicular applications where load-dump ABSORP HON and field decay transients occur. The LDTS protects across-the-line de power systems from Load Dump and Field Decay Voltage Transient Susceptibility on Power Leads. © DESIGNED FOR OC POWER APPLICATIONS © LOW CLAMPING RATIO MAXIMUM RATINGS +
3000 Watts of Peak Pulse Power dissipation at 50ms (see Figure 1) ons aL gate
